Solution for 0.09-0.01(x+2)=-0.02(4-x) equation:


Simplifying
0.09 + -0.01(x + 2) = -0.02(4 + -1x)

Reorder the terms:
0.09 + -0.01(2 + x) = -0.02(4 + -1x)
0.09 + (2 * -0.01 + x * -0.01) = -0.02(4 + -1x)
0.09 + (-0.02 + -0.01x) = -0.02(4 + -1x)

Combine like terms: 0.09 + -0.02 = 0.07
0.07 + -0.01x = -0.02(4 + -1x)
0.07 + -0.01x = (4 * -0.02 + -1x * -0.02)
0.07 + -0.01x = (-0.08 + 0.02x)

Solving
0.07 + -0.01x = -0.08 + 0.02x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-0.02x' to each side of the equation.
0.07 + -0.01x + -0.02x = -0.08 + 0.02x + -0.02x

Combine like terms: -0.01x + -0.02x = -0.03x
0.07 + -0.03x = -0.08 + 0.02x + -0.02x

Combine like terms: 0.02x + -0.02x = 0.00
0.07 + -0.03x = -0.08 + 0.00
0.07 + -0.03x = -0.08

Add '-0.07' to each side of the equation.
0.07 + -0.07 + -0.03x = -0.08 + -0.07

Combine like terms: 0.07 + -0.07 = 0.00
0.00 + -0.03x = -0.08 + -0.07
-0.03x = -0.08 + -0.07

Combine like terms: -0.08 + -0.07 = -0.15
-0.03x = -0.15

Divide each side by '-0.03'.
x = 5

Simplifying
x = 5
